Compensation platform expected to open next week
The platform where people who incurred damages from this week's Attica wildfire can apply for compensation will open on August 21, according to Deputy Civil Protection Minister Christos Triandopoulos. Inspections in the affected municipalities are ongoing, with 130 having been conducted by Thursday.

Land burnt equivalent to 2.5% of Attica area
Teams of the General Directorate for the Rehabilitation of the Effects of Natural Disasters of the Ministry of Climate Crisis and Policy began the process of recording damage on Tuesday in the aftermath of the devastating fire that ripped through northern Athens on Sunday and Monday.

Some schools closed due to bad weather
Following heavy snowfall and icy conditions across the region of Attica, several municipalities announced that schools in their areas would remain closed on Thursday.
Schools in the areas of Thrakomakedones, Varibobi, Kifissia, Vrilissia and Penteli, northern Attica, were closed on Thursday.
